The image shows the ruins of St. Nicholas' Church (St. Nikolai Kirche) in Hamburg, Germany. The church's Gothic spire, blackened by time and weather, dominates the skyline against a clear blue sky with scattered white clouds. The main body of the church is a skeletal ruin, with crumbling stone walls, arched openings, and visible internal structural elements. The building appears to be a historical monument and tourist attraction, as evidenced by the presence of people walking around the site. In the foreground, a paved area with cobblestones transitions to a lighter colored paving. Several individuals are visible walking on the paved areas, some in groups, others individually. A bicycle is parked near a grassy incline. The ruins are surrounded by trees and modern buildings, indicating an urban environment. The lighting suggests it is daytime, likely mid-morning or afternoon.
